It releases on May 5th, but do you have the system required to push the gore-splattered shooter?

If you’ve played The New Order, the answer is almost certainly yes, unless your computer has been lobotomised since last year. For those coming to Wolfenstein for the first time though, The Old Blood requires:

  • Intel Core i5 2500 / AMD FX-8320 CPU
  • 4GB RAM
  • Nvidia Geforce GTX560 / AMD Radeon HD 6870 with 1GB VRAM

but Machine Games reccomends you have:

  • Intel Core i7 / AMD FX-8350 CPU
  • 8GB RAM
  • Nvidia Geforce GTX660 / AMD Radeon R9 280 with 3BG VRAM

The game needs 38GB of harddrive space, so you may want to pre-load if you want to play on day one.
